Staff attempted to notify property owners within 700 feet <br />of the subject property. <br /> <br />Observations: <br /> <br />Darrel Kruger owns a 27.01-acre parcel on Ramsey Blvd. south of 159th Lane NW. The <br />developer, Wurm-Paumen Properties, LLC, is applying for a major subdivision that proposes five <br />new lots, all of which are larger than the 2.5-acre minimum required in the R-1, Rural Developing <br />Area. <br /> <br />The ex/sting homestead is located on proposed Lot 5 and the structure will remain after the other <br />lots are developed. Lot 5 also contains a second dwelling unit that will be removed as part of the <br />development. The plat also conta/ns Outlot A, which is located across Ramsey Blvd. from the <br />main tract. The outlot is entirely wetland. <br /> <br />Wurm-Paumen Properties, LLC is proposing to emend 158~' Lane NW into the Parcel to provide <br />access to four of the lots. Due to the substantial amount of wetland on the property, Lot 1 will <br />require access from Country Road 56. <br /> <br />The property is also subject to the Ramsey Park and Trail Plan and will be required to dedicate a <br />75-ft. trail corridor connecting Central Park and Elm Crest Park. A revised preliminary plat was <br />submitted that shows the trail corridor. The exact area of the trail will need to be verified before <br />the Park Commission can draft a formal Park Dedication recommendation. <br /> <br /> <br />
